There is no single safest sports betting app, and the pages that name one are ranking brands by their offers rather than by anything about the software. What can actually be judged is the install: which route the file took onto the phone, who checked it along the way, and what the app asks to reach once it is running. Those three things are inspectable in a few minutes, and they differ far more between two install routes than between two operators.

Why do betting apps in Bangladesh usually arrive as an APK file?

Because the large app stores will not carry them, and the reason is a licensing condition no operator can satisfy here.

Google's own policy states that Play generally prohibits apps that facilitate real-money gambling, and allows them in select countries only, after an application to Google, from developers registered as a licensed operator with the appropriate governmental gambling authority in the specified country who also provide a valid operating licence for that country. Every word of that condition points at a national regulator. Bangladesh does not have one, because it has no domestic licensing regime for online gambling at all, which is the same fact underneath what the law actually says about betting in Bangladesh.

So the store route closes, and the file comes from the operator's own website instead. Two things follow from that, and they pull in opposite directions. The absence from the store is not a verdict on the operator: it is a jurisdiction rule, and it would shut out a scrupulous company and a careless one identically. But every check the store would have performed is now unperformed, and the person holding the phone is the only one left to perform it.

What is the safest sports betting app: the store version or the file you download?

Asked that way the question has an answer. The store route takes work off you; the downloaded file hands all of it back.

Four differences do the work, and none of them is about the app's features:

Who vetted the publisher. A store listing is bound to a developer account the store checked, and the company name on that listing is a claim someone is accountable for. A file sitting on a web page is bound to nothing except that page.

What examined the file. Store apps are reviewed before publication and scanned again on the device. A downloaded APK gets the on-device scan and nothing else, because no review of that specific file ever happened.

How the next version arrives. Store updates install themselves, and Android will only accept an update signed with the same key as the version already installed. That rule turns the update channel into a continuous identity check. With a hand-installed file you repeat the original judgement every time, from scratch.

What you switch off. Nothing, in the first case. In the second, you grant an app the power to install other apps, which is a permission Android deliberately does not give out by default.

The route, not the brand, is where most of the difference sits. The operator's app page sets out what the Android install involves, and the checks that apply to the website behind it are a separate exercise covered in how to check a betting site before trusting it.

Which betting app is safe to install, if sideloading is the only route?

No app is made safe by the way it is installed, but almost all of the avoidable risk sits in four decisions you control.

  1. Reach the download page by typing the operator's domain yourself. Not from a link in a message, not from an advert, not from a video description. A fake file does not have to be found to reach you; it is sent, wrapped in a link that resembles the real address closely enough to survive a glance.
  2. Grant the install permission to one app only. Android handles this through what its documentation calls special permissions, listed under special app access in settings. Give it to the browser you are downloading with, and to nothing else, least of all a chat app.
  3. Watch the first minute after installing. The requests an app makes on first launch are the clearest statement it will ever make about what it intends to touch.
  4. Remember where the file came from. The next version has to come from the same place, and an update offered from anywhere else is not an update.

Is it safe for a betting app to have your social, contacts or SMS?

Those are three different questions, and Android's permission model answers them differently. The platform sorts permissions into install-time, runtime and special: install-time permissions are granted automatically when the app is installed, runtime permissions (the documentation also calls them dangerous permissions) prompt you the first time the app needs them, and special permissions cover particularly powerful actions and live in their own settings screen.

That grading is the useful part, because it tells you which permissions an app already has without ever asking.

SMS is the one worth pausing on. A betting app has a genuine reason to want it, namely reading a login code so you do not have to type it. It is also the channel your bank and your mobile wallet use for their own codes, and an app that can read one message can read all of them. Declining it costs you the time it takes to copy a code by hand.

Contacts has no betting function behind it. Referral features need it, and a referral feature is marketing rather than betting.

Signing in with a social account is a different mechanism altogether and often gets lumped in wrongly. It gives the app no access to your phone. It gives the operator whatever the social network's consent screen lists, which is displayed at the moment you approve it and is easy to accept unread, because it stands between you and the account you were trying to open.

All of this stays reversible. Runtime permissions can be withdrawn from settings after install, and withdrawing one uninstalls nothing: the feature that depended on it simply stops working, which is a decent way of finding out what it was for.

How do you tell the app's publisher is really the operator?

On a store listing you read the developer name and check it against the company named in the operator's terms and licence details. Without a listing, that check has nowhere to live, so it moves earlier in the process, to the path you took to reach the file.

The app name and the icon are the two things an impostor copies first, and copying them costs nothing. The signing key is the identity that cannot be faked, but Android exposes it to you only indirectly, by refusing an update signed with a different key. So the first install carries all the risk, and every later one only has to match it. An installer that arrives as a chat attachment is not the operator's file until the operator's own domain says it is.

What should you do if an app or a site turns out to be fake?

Report it, then contain it. Bangladesh's government incident response team, BGD e-GOV CIRT, receives incident reports and publishes advisories, and a fraudulent app aimed at Bangladeshi users is squarely the kind of thing it exists to collect.

Containing it means treating every credential typed into that app as exposed: change the same password anywhere else it was used, and change the wallet PIN if it was ever entered. Removing the app stops it collecting more, but it does not retrieve what already left.

Can you use the mobile site instead of installing anything?

Yes, and it removes this whole category of risk rather than reducing it. A page in a browser holds no install-time permissions, stops when you close the tab, and leaves nothing behind that needs updating. What you give up is push notifications and anything that has to work without a connection.

Does switching "install unknown apps" back off remove the app?

No. That permission governs future installs by the app holding it, not apps already on the phone. Switching it off afterwards leaves the betting app running exactly as before and closes the door behind it, which is why Android made it per-app rather than one device-wide setting. The one thing it changes is that the next update will not install until you grant it again, and that prompt is worth having: it is the moment you get to ask where this file came from.

Is an iPhone automatically safer for this?

Safer for this specific risk, but not automatically. iOS has no equivalent of the switch that lets a browser install an app, so outside the App Store there is no ordinary way to put a file on the phone. What exists instead is a different route: an operator with no App Store listing may offer an install that first asks you to accept a configuration profile in settings, and that prompt deserves the same question as the Android one, namely whose domain served it and whether you reached that domain by typing the address yourself. The flip side is that an absent iOS app tells you nothing about the operator, since that store applies its own regional restrictions to real-money gambling, so a missing app is as likely to mean a closed jurisdiction as a problem with the company.
